Another common poison was the COBRA – flashgun HVL-F58AM to be exact.
Why called cobra? Because its the only flashgun that can swivel right and left with flash still facing front.
Size comparison between my F42 and F58. F58 was much larger and could bump into my head while looking into optical view. The moving mechanism was very smooth! Compared to my F42 which have to press a button to unlock head position before it allows to swivel around.

But for me the most poisonous part was the flash diffuser. Strange enough huh?
I managed to test the between diffuser shot and non-diffuser shot.
Here the shots:
EXIF of both shots:
Focal length: 50mm
F-number:Â F/1.7
Exposure time: 1/80 sec
ISO speed: ISO 100
Of course some people may ask: “Isn’t it the brighter the better?”
The answer is no. Non diffused flash kills the ambient light and too harsh for portraiture – which will caused unpleasent reflection on skin tone. Not to mention it wiped out the white balance and causes harsh shadow of subject.
